第4章(1)数组.pptVIP

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
PHP数组 数组 分类:枚举数组、关联数组和多维数组 枚举数组:下标为整数的数组 例如:$stu[1] = “张三” 关联数组:用字符串做为下标的数组 例如:$stu[“name”] = “张三” $stu[“sex”]=“女” $stu[“age”]=“16” PHP 数组初始化 $stu[] = “张军” $stu[] = “李三” $stu[]=“Tom” $stu[]=“王五” 使用array函数 例如: $stu = array(“james”,”jack”,”Toms”) 数组的起始下标可以不从0开始 $stu = array(2=”james”,”jack”,”Toms”) 表示下标从2开始 $arr = array[“name”=”james”,”sex”=”boy”] PHP 数组的操作 1、unset() 删除数组元素 unset($arr) 删除整个数组 unset($arr[0]) 删除单个数组元素 2、输出数组 print_r($arr); 3、数组遍历 用for循环; 用函数foreach(); 格式1:foreach($arr as $value) 输出数组中的元素 格式2:foreach($arr as $key=$value) 输出数组中的下标和元素 PHP 用While循环。 1)each() 返回数组中当前的键/值对并 将数组指针向前移动一步 返回4个值 0和key是键名,1和 value是键值 如:$arr = array(4=Testuser,Toms,Andych); $foo = each($arr); print_r($foo); Array ( [1] = Test user [value] = Test user [0] = 4 [key] = 4 ) PHP 2)list() 把数组中的值赋给一些变量 如:list($var) = $arr 注意:list函数仅用于数组下标从0开始 的数组 3)二维数组遍历 PHP current() 返回数组中当前元素 如:current($arr) next() 将数组的指针移到下一个元素上 如:next($arr) prev() 将数组的指针移到上一个元素上 如:prev($arr) range() 自动生成一个包含指定范围单元的 数组 如:range(0,40,5) PHP count() 统计数组中元素个数 如:count($arr) array_count_values() 统计数组中相同 元素的个数 PHP函数 内置函数 1、echo() 输出一个或多个字符串 如:echo “PHP”.“程序设计”.$var; PHP函数 2、print() 输出字符串 如:print(“PHP程序设计”); 用法同echo 注意: 35?print(“错误的逻辑”):print(“正确的逻辑”) PHP函数 3、include / require 函数 功能:包含并运行指定的文件 。 格式:include “a.php”; 说明:如果上面的函数用在条件语句中,一定要写在{}内. 被包含的文件中可以使用return 语句。 If($a==$b) { include “a.php”; }else{ include “b.php”; } PHP函数 $b = include(“a.php”); If($b==“ok”) { echo “File is Ok”; } a.php文件 ?return “ok”? 注意:在包含文件中函数执行到return将会终止。 PHP函数 自定义函数 1、函数声明 格式: function func_name($arg1,$arg2…$argn) { 语句集; return value; } 根据函数是否包含参数:无参函数 和 有参函数 PHP函数 2、无参函数 例:定义函数,计算100以内偶数之和 function func_sum() { $sum = 0; for($a=0;$a=100;$a++) { if($a%2==0){ $sum += $a;} } } func_sum(); //调用函数 PHP函数 PHP函数 (2)按地址传递 $num = 100; Function func($b) { $b = $b + 10; } Func($sum); PHP函数 3)默认值函数 定义函数时,给参数赋值;在调用函数若不指定参数内容

文档评论(0)

80092355km +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档